Subject: [PATCH 23/24] nohz: Don't stop the tick if posix cpu timers are running
Date: Thu, 20 Dec 2012 19:33:10 +0100	[thread overview]
Message-ID: <1356028391-14427-24-git-send-email-fweisbec@gmail.com> (raw)
In-Reply-To: <1356028391-14427-1-git-send-email-fweisbec@gmail.com>

If either a per thread or a per process posix cpu timer is running,
don't stop the tick.

TODO: restart the tick if it is stopped and a posix cpu timer is
enqueued. Check we probably need a memory barrier for the per
process posix timer that can be enqueued from another task
of the group.

---
 include/linux/posix-timers.h |    1 +
 kernel/posix-cpu-timers.c    |   11 +++++++++++
 kernel/time/tick-sched.c     |    4 ++++
 3 files changed, 16 insertions(+), 0 deletions(-)

diff --git a/include/linux/posix-timers.h b/include/linux/posix-timers.h
index 042058f..97480c2 100644
--- a/include/linux/posix-timers.h
+++ b/include/linux/posix-timers.h
@@ -119,6 +119,7 @@ int posix_timer_event(struct k_itimer *timr, int si_private);
 void posix_cpu_timer_schedule(struct k_itimer *timer);
 
 void run_posix_cpu_timers(struct task_struct *task);
+bool posix_cpu_timers_running(struct task_struct *tsk);
 void posix_cpu_timers_exit(struct task_struct *task);
 void posix_cpu_timers_exit_group(struct task_struct *task);
 
diff --git a/kernel/posix-cpu-timers.c b/kernel/posix-cpu-timers.c
index 3d58bd5..d3b46b3 100644
--- a/kernel/posix-cpu-timers.c
+++ b/kernel/posix-cpu-timers.c
@@ -1266,6 +1266,17 @@ static inline int fastpath_timer_check(struct task_struct *tsk)
 	return 0;
 }
 
+bool posix_cpu_timers_running(struct task_struct *tsk)
+{
+	if (!task_cputime_zero(&tsk->cputime_expires))
+		return true;
+
+	if (tsk->signal->cputimer.running)
+		return true;
+
+	return false;
+}
+
 /*
  * This is called from the timer interrupt handler.  The irq handler has
  * already updated our counts.  We need to check if any timers fire now.
diff --git a/kernel/time/tick-sched.c b/kernel/time/tick-sched.c
index 0c9281a..4f4fa13 100644
--- a/kernel/time/tick-sched.c
+++ b/kernel/time/tick-sched.c
@@ -21,6 +21,7 @@
 #include <linux/sched.h>
 #include <linux/module.h>
 #include <linux/irq_work.h>
+#include <linux/posix-timers.h>
 
 #include <asm/irq_regs.h>
 
@@ -597,6 +598,9 @@ static bool can_stop_full_tick(int cpu)
 	if (rcu_pending(cpu))
 		return false;
 
+	if (posix_cpu_timers_running(current))
+		return false;
+
 	return true;
 }
 #endif
